[The marker histochemical detection of glucose-6-phosphate residues in the human placenta]. 1992

A L Glazyrin, and S I Kolesnikov

Glucose-6-phosphate residues were revealed by fine structural analysis using glucose-6-phosphate dehydrogenase-gold conjugate. In human mature placenta specific staining was detected over the stroma of placental villi. Colloidal gold particles were found over the collagen fibrils and reticular lamina of basal membrane. Syncytiotrophoblast cells, fibroblasts, endothelial cells of fetal capillaries avoided labelling. Nucleated blood cells and thrombocytes inside the lumen of fetal capillaries demonstrated intense staining. The present investigation demonstrates histochemically the process of extracellular glycosylation. Glycated collagen fibrils formed channels inside the stroma of placental villi.
